Deciding whether or not to seek chiropractic care often involves understanding the potential monetary implications. While costs can fluctuate based on factors such as location, complexity of treatment, and insurance coverage, there are some general expectations to keep in mind.
A standard initial consultation may include a thorough history review, physical examination, and possibly X-rays, with costs ranging from around $50 to $200. Subsequent adjustments typically cost less per visit, often falling in the range of $30 to $100.
It's important to talk about your insurance coverage and any potential out-of-pocket costs upfront with the chiropractor. Many plans offer limited coverage for chiropractic care, so it's advisable to check your benefits before scheduling appointments.

Understanding Chiropractor Costs for Neck Pain Relief
Experiencing persistent neck pain can be a real drag. While it might tempt you to pop a painkiller and hope for the best, sometimes you need professional help. A chiropractor can provide relief that targets the root cause of your neck discomfort. But before you book an appointment, it's wise to understand how much a visit to the chiropractor will cost.
The price tag for chiropractic care can vary depending on several factors, such as location, experience of the doctor, and the type of your neck pain. A single session could range from around $50 to upwards of $200, but some chiropractors offer package deals or discounts for returning clients.
- Explore your insurance coverage. Some health plans partially cover chiropractic care, so it's worth checking with your provider to see what benefits you have.
- Find chiropractors who offer payment plans or sliding scale fees if cost is a major concern.
- Don't hesitate to ask about the estimated cost before scheduling an appointment. Transparency is key!
